REO/Foreclosure Listing Agent - CA
Adrian Petrila Team
Agent job in Fresno, CA
Job Description
REO / Foreclosure Real Estate Listing Agent - Exclusive Opportunities with {{team_name}}
Are you a seasoned Californiaagent ready to excel in the REO and foreclosure market? Or a dedicated real estate professional eager to enter one of the industry's most consistent, high-volume niches?
At {{team_name}}, we are uniquely positioned, having placed over 1,400 REO listings with our agents in the past year, and our pipeline continues to grow. Our agents are at capacity, and we are seeking more qualified listing agents to manage the incoming inventory.
We maintain exclusive relationships with multiple national asset managers. When listings come in, they are directly assigned to our team's agents. This is not a competitive lead environment; these are direct assignments ready for you to list, market, and sell.
One of our Dallas agents has received over 108 assignments since December, and he's just getting started!
Why Join {{team_name}}?
Consistent, High-Volume Listings - Avoid cold calls and endless prospecting. We provide a steady stream of REO/foreclosure listings from our exclusive asset manager partners.
Comprehensive Support - We manage the backend: marketing, transaction coordination, and compliance, allowing you to focus on selling.
Proven REO Systems Training - From BPOs to cash-for-keys, occupancy checks, and lender-required repairs, we guide you through our streamlined processes.
Accelerated Payment - Our perfected REO workflow helps you move assets quickly and close more deals each month.
Your Responsibilities
List and market assigned REO and foreclosure properties according to client requirements.
Complete BPOs, occupancy checks, and property condition reports.
Coordinate lender-approved repairs and manage vendor relationships.
Host property access for inspections, appraisals, and showings.
Negotiate offers in compliance with asset manager instructions.
Maintain accurate, timely communication with clients and asset managers.
The Ideal Candidate
REO / Foreclosure Experience Preferred - Experience with asset managers, banks, or government agencies is advantageous.
Experienced Agents Considered - We offer REO-specific training if you have a strong real estate sales track record.
Tech-savvy and comfortable using multiple platforms for task management and reporting.
Organized, deadline-driven, and detail-oriented.
California Real Estate License (required).
What Sets Us Apart
While others chase cold leads, you'll be handed sellable inventory from day one. Our exclusive relationships mean you're not competing with other agents in the MLS for the same listings; you're managing assets directly assigned to you.

Showing Agent - Rental Property Showings
Doorstead
Agent job in Fresno, CA
FIELD ASSOCIATE - FRESNO AREA ABOUT THE ROLE We're seeking a Field Associate to join our team in the Fresno area. This contracted hourly position is a 1099 position that focuses on conducting property showings for rental properties with occasional opportunities to conduct property evaluations. Showings are typically scheduled for thirty minutes and evaluations for one hour.
Key Responsibilities:
* Property Showings:
* Travel to properties and conduct showings for prospective tenants
* Ensure property accessibility and secure property when leaving
* Report prospect and property feedback
* Paid commute time
* Property Evaluations (optional):
* Assess property conditions at management start, move-ins, and move-outs
* Use Doorstead tooling to document property deficiencies
* Work independently and efficiently (average evaluation time of 1 hour)
* Evaluate exterior areas, interior common spaces, and basic functionality of electric and plumbing systems
* Take detailed photos and prepare basic reports through our system
